How do I use the Alarm Clock feature on the Stylus 1000?
The alarm clock feature causes the camera to play an audio cue at a predetermined time or interval. To use the alarm clock, you must first set the cameras date and time. Note that if DUALTIME is set to ON, the alarm will sound according to the DUALTIME date and time settings, not those of the camera default date and time. With the mode dial set to any shooting mode or playback mode except GUIDE, press the MENU button. Use the arrow pad to select SETUP, and then press the OK/FUNC button. Use the Up and Down arrows to navigate to ALARM CLOCK. Press the Right arrow to advance to the next screen. Use the Up and Down arrows to select the frequency with which the alarm should activate. ONE TIME means the alarm will ring at the appointed time; DAILY means the alarm will ring each day at the appointed time. Whichever choice you select, you must press the Right arrow to continue.
